Unordinary has definitely sparked my imagination and reflection on various social themes that hit close to home. For starters, the power dynamics depicted in the series are striking. The world is stratified based on abilities, which serves as a poignant metaphor for real-world issues like classism and privilege. You have the 'Normals' who face constant oppression from the 'Abnormals', mirroring how society today often divides people based on wealth, status, or even race. As I read through the story, I was reminded of various movements advocating for equality—it's almost like the characters are living analogies of today’s social struggles.
Another layer that stands out is the mental health aspect. I feel like the characters in 'Unordinary' face intense pressures that parallel what many of us experience today. The protagonist, John, struggles profoundly with his identity and the burdens that come with it. Here’s where the writing brilliantly opens up conversations about depression, anxiety, and the importance of mental wellness, especially in environments that celebrate power and strength over vulnerability.
Lastly, the series doesn't shy away from elements of bullying and isolation, showcasing the impact of these issues on both a personal and societal level. It taps into the emotions many teens and young adults face today, making 'Unordinary' not just an entertaining read, but a mirror reflecting some very real dilemmas that resonate with a lot of us on a deep level.
